Types of WiFi Cards

I discovered that there are mainly two types of WiFi cards: PCIe cards and USB adapters. PCIe cards are installed directly onto the motherboard and generally offer better performance and range. On the other hand, USB adapters are easy to install and portable, making them suitable for those who may want to use them on multiple devices.

WiFi Standards

As I researched further, I learned about various WiFi standards, such as 802.11n, 802.11ac, and the latest 802.11ax (Wi-Fi 6). The latest standard provides better speeds and improved performance in crowded environments. I decided that investing in a Wi-Fi 6 card would future-proof my setup.

Speed and Range

Speed and range were crucial factors for me. I wanted to ensure that my WiFi card could handle high-speed internet, especially for gaming and streaming. I looked for cards that supported dual-band frequencies (2.4GHz and 5GHz) to maximize my connectivity options. The range also mattered since my desktop is located farther from the router.

Antennas and Design

I noticed that some WiFi cards come with external antennas, while others have internal ones. External antennas often provide better signal strength and range, which I found appealing. I also considered the design of the card, ensuring it would fit into my desktop case without blocking other components.

Installation Process

Before making a purchase, I wanted to ensure that the installation process would be straightforward. I looked for cards that came with clear instructions and required minimal tools. I preferred cards that didn’t need additional power connectors, simplifying the setup process.

Driver and Software Support

Driver compatibility was another essential aspect I considered. I wanted a WiFi card with robust driver support for my operating system. I also appreciated cards that offered user-friendly software to manage network settings and monitor performance.
